Create new kubeconfig file
WebJun 22, 2024 · kubectluses the kubeconfig file to determine which cluster to use for running any commands. kubecontext: a group of access parameters containing information related to your cluster, user, and namespace and defined inside your kubeconfig file. kuebctl checks the current context defined in the kubeconfig file and runs the command against … WebMay 26, 2024 · What this says is that you can create or modify contexts in your kubeconfig file with the command kubectl config set-context.This command also accepts the name …
Create new kubeconfig file
Did you know?
WebThe following can be used to create a config with Kubernetes as the default orchestrator using the existing kubeconfig stored in /home/ubuntu/.kube/config. For this to work, you will need a valid kubeconfig file in /home/ubuntu/.kube/config. WebDec 6, 2024 · Writes kubeconfig files in /etc/kubernetes/ for the kubelet, the controller-manager and the scheduler to use to connect to the API server, each with its own identity, as well as an additional kubeconfig file for administration named admin.conf. Generates static Pod manifests for the API server, controller-manager and scheduler.
WebCreate the Kubernetes Service Account You can use the following manifest to create a service account. Replace NAMESPACE with the namespace you want to use and, optionally, rename the service account. # spinnaker-service-account.yml apiVersion: v1 kind: ServiceAccount metadata: name: spinnaker-service-account namespace: NAMESPACE WebMar 22, 2024 · You can download the new signed public key from the csr resource: kubectl get csr user-request-devopstales -o jsonpath=' {.status.certificate}' base64 -d > devopstales-user.crt Create new user config file
WebThis command adds a cluster named my-cluster to the kubeconfig file, with the specified server URL and CA data.. Step 3: Add a user to the kubeconfig file. To add a user to the kubeconfig file, use the kubectl config set-credentials command. This command requires the name of the user, the user's client certificate, and the user's client key. WebA kubeconfig file is a file used to configure access to Kubernetes when used in conjunction with the kubectl commandline tool (or other clients). For more details on how kubeconfig and kubectl work together, see the Kubernetes documentation. When you deployed Kubernetes, a kubeconfig is automatically generated for your RKE cluster.
Webalso note that you could use export KUBECONFIG=alice-config on your machine to generate a single alice-config file (with certs embedded) and just send that to alice …
WebJan 31, 2024 · Method 1: Connect to Kubernetes Cluster With Kubeconfig Kubectl Context Step 1: Move kubeconfig to .kube directory.. Kubectl interacts with the … jesireeWebNote: A file that is used to configure access to clusters is called a kubeconfig file. This is a generic way of referring to configuration files. It does not mean that there is a file named … lamp 1156WebMar 13, 2024 · Download ZIP Create a service account and generate a kubeconfig file for it - this will also set the default namespace for the user Raw kubernetes_add_service_account_kubeconfig.sh #!/bin/bash set -e set -o pipefail # Add user to k8s using service account, no RBAC (must create RBAC after this script) if [ [ -z … jesiree ageWebNote: A file that is used to configure access to clusters is called a kubeconfig file. This is a generic way of referring to configuration files. It does not mean that there is a file named kubeconfig. Warning: Only use kubeconfig files from trusted sources. Using a specially-crafted kubeconfig file could result in malicious code execution or ... lamp 1141WebApr 12, 2024 · Solution Certificates API. 1. A new member akshay joined our team. He requires access to our cluster. The Certificate Signing Request is at the /root location. 2. … jesiree dizonWebFeb 11, 2024 · Create a file lancelot-csr.yaml and generate the k8s resource with kubectl create -f lancelot-csr.yaml. apiVersion: ... We added a new cluster, user and context to our kubeconfig. We tried to use the new credentials to list all pods in a given namespace and discovered that a user without roles cannot do anything on a k8s cluster! lamp120WebDec 12, 2024 · How to create a kubectl config file for serviceaccount. I have a kubernetes cluster on Azure and I created 2 namespaces and 2 service accounts because I have two teams deploying on the cluster. I want to give each team their own kubeconfig file for the serviceaccount I created. jesi recanati